[0001] This utility model relates to the field of baling machine technology, and in particular to a baling machine capable of bidirectional material discharge. Background Technology
[0002] Horizontal balers typically employ a horizontal feeding and compression method to compress loose materials (such as waste paper, plastic, cardboard, etc.) into regular blocks, which are then bundled using wire, steel straps, or plastic straps via an automatic strapping device. Currently, most horizontal hydraulic balers on the market use unidirectional discharge. For example, the side-discharge horizontal baler with publication number CN 208761058 U uses unidirectional side discharge; the hydraulic horizontal baler with buffer door safety device and publication number CN 216076782 U uses unidirectional horizontal discharge. The above-mentioned unidirectional discharge balers have the following problems in actual use: 1. The pusher extension can only push material on one side, resulting in low discharge efficiency; 2. A single material inlet and a single material baling area mean that only one type of material can be baled, leading to low baling efficiency; 3. During material sorting, one type of material enters the baler, while the other type of material screened out needs to be stacked in the yard and re-collected and baled, increasing the baling process. Using two devices for baling processing increases costs. Utility Model Content

[0029] Example 1, such as Figure 1 As shown, a double-headed baling machine includes a chassis 1, which is a rectangular steel structure, with its length defined as transverse. In this embodiment, both ends of the chassis 1 are provided with transverse discharge ports 100, i.e., the chassis adopts a double discharge port. A bidirectional pusher 9, corresponding to the transverse discharge ports 100, is provided in the middle of the chassis 1. The bidirectional pusher can push material in both forward and backward directions, allowing for simultaneous pushing in both directions or a single extension and retraction action, enabling pushing in one direction while not pushing in the other, thus making the pushing method more flexible. The inner cavity of the chassis corresponding to the bidirectional pusher 9 and the corresponding transverse discharge port 100 is sequentially set as a feeding area and a baling area along the discharge direction. Therefore, in this embodiment, the chassis has two feeding areas and two baling areas, allowing for the simultaneous baling of two types of materials. A feeding hopper 2 is provided on the upper part of the chassis 1 corresponding to the feeding area. In this embodiment, the chassis has two feeding hoppers, which can be used for simultaneous feeding of two types of materials, avoiding the re-collection of materials screened before feeding, simplifying the screening work before baling, and improving the efficiency of the entire baling process. This embodiment, through the cooperation of the bidirectional pusher with double feed hoppers, double packaging areas and two lateral discharge ports, can simultaneously package two types of materials and push them out of the chamber synchronously or asynchronously, thereby improving packaging efficiency and discharge efficiency. This double-headed packaging machine integrates two packaging devices, which greatly increases production capacity while reducing production costs, meeting market demands.

[0032] Example 4, as Figure 2 As shown, a double-headed baling machine is further optimized based on embodiment 1, 2, or 3. In this embodiment, the bidirectional pusher 9 includes a bidirectional hydraulic cylinder 91 and two symmetrically arranged push plates 92. The two push plates 92 are respectively connected to both ends of the bidirectional hydraulic cylinder 91. The push plates 92 slide or roll with the machine housing 1. When the push plates 92 slide with the machine housing 1, the push plates directly contact the machine housing 1, and there is sliding contact between the two. When the push plates 92 roll with the machine housing 1, rollers are provided at the bottom of the push plates or at the bottom of the machine housing, and rollers are provided between the push plates and the machine housing 1, and there is rolling contact between the two. It should be noted that the bidirectional hydraulic cylinder can be a double-headed hydraulic cylinder or a single-headed cylinder. When using a double-headed hydraulic cylinder, both ends can work synchronously to compress the material in the two baling areas simultaneously or alternately; alternatively, either end can work independently, stopping one pusher and allowing the other pusher to work independently. When operating synchronously at both ends, the cylinder is fixed, one piston rod extends while the other retracts, and both piston rods move synchronously to alternately compress the material at both ends; alternatively, both piston rods can extend and retract synchronously to compress the material in both packaging areas simultaneously. When operating at one end, the cylinder is fixed, one piston rod stops working, and the other piston rod extends and retracts independently to compress the material at that end. When using a single-head cylinder, two single-head cylinders are required, with their piston rods connected to two push plates respectively; this also allows for simultaneous or individual operation of the two push plates.
[0033] As a preferred embodiment, the pusher plate 92 in this embodiment is a box-type structure with an open rear end, ensuring stable movement within the casing 1 while maintaining high strength for efficient material pushing and compression. In this embodiment, the pusher plate 92 is slidably positioned within the casing. A reinforcing plate 93 is provided on the front end face of the pusher plate 92 to improve its pushing stability. Several threading grooves Ⅰ94 are longitudinally formed on the reinforcing plate 93; these threading grooves Ⅰ94 correspond to the thread-passing grooves 11 on the side wall of the casing 1 in the packaging area; they facilitate the smooth passage of binding ropes. After the material is compressed and formed, the binding ropes are led out through the thread-passing grooves and thread-passing grooves for easy knotting, completing the rapid binding of the material. In this embodiment, a hydraulic cylinder support 95 is provided in the middle of the casing 1, and a bidirectional hydraulic cylinder 91 is laterally positioned on the hydraulic cylinder support 95. The hydraulic cylinder support provides stable support for the bidirectional hydraulic cylinder 91.
[0034] Example 5, as Figure 4 As shown, a double-headed baling machine is further optimized based on embodiments 1, 2, 3, or 4. In this embodiment, the machine housing 1 corresponding to the baling area is provided with a top pressing mechanism 3 and / or a side clamping mechanism 13. By setting the top pressing mechanism 3 at the top, it is used to perform downward single-sided compression forming of the material in the baling area. By setting the side clamping mechanisms 13 on both sides, it is used to perform double-sided clamping compression forming of the material in the baling area. By setting the top pressing mechanism 3 at the top and the side clamping mechanisms 13 on both sides, it is used to perform downward pressing and double-sided clamping three-sided compression forming of the material in the baling area. The specific situation can be determined according to the actual situation. The appropriate method is selected based on the actual situation; the above-mentioned clamping structure, together with the door 4 at the transverse discharge port 100, forms a comprehensive baler; the opening and closing of the transverse discharge end is achieved by opening and closing the door, which is also used for switching between two modes. This comprehensive baler has two working modes: clamp arm baling mode and door baling mode; in clamp arm baling mode, the door is open, which is used for continuous baling of large quantities of materials to ensure baling efficiency; in door baling mode, the door is closed, and the materials can be small, loose materials such as shredded paper and aluminum cans, or large materials such as cardboard boxes, which are mainly for working conditions with fewer materials. This mode is used for non-continuous baling operations.
[0035] In this embodiment, the top pressing mechanism 3 includes an upper pressing plate 31. An upper driving member 32 is provided on the housing 1 to drive the upper pressing plate 31 downwards. Under the action of the upper driving member 32, the upper pressing plate 31 can perform a vertical downward pressing action in the packaging area. The upper pressing plate matches the upper opening of the housing to cover the upper part of the packaging area. The driving member provides the power for the upper pressing plate to move up and down. When moving downwards, it can press down on the material in the packaging area, compacting the material in that area for easy packaging. Specifically, in this embodiment, one end of the upper pressing plate 31 near the feed hopper 2 is hinged to the housing 1 via a first longitudinal pin 34, and the other end corresponds to the hatch 4. Under the action of the driving member, it rotates up and down around the hinge point, or swings up and down, applying a greater force to the material near the hatch area, while the material near the feed hopper area experiences relatively less force. Thus, the material pile pressed out by the upper pressing plate is conical. Under the pushing action of the transverse pusher, the material forms a conical discharge, which facilitates discharge and further compacts the material laterally, improving the material forming rate. The correspondence between the upper pressure plate and the hatch 4 means that when not pressing down, the upper pressure plate is in contact with the hatch or has a small gap to prevent the spillage of fine materials; when pressing down, the upper pressure plate and the hatch will not interfere with each other. The upper drive component 32 is a vertically arranged first hydraulic cylinder, which is connected to the machine housing 1 through a support base 35. The telescopic end of the first hydraulic cylinder is hinged to the upper pressure plate 31. Specifically, the telescopic end of the first hydraulic cylinder is hinged to the upper pressure plate using a pin, and the connecting pin is located at about 1 / 5 of the front part of the upper pressure plate to ensure that the material in the packaging area is pressed down and compacted obliquely and evenly. It should be noted that the drive component can also be a cylinder if needed. The drive component that provides the power for up and down movement and the first telescopic hydraulic cylinder belong to the same inventive concept.
[0036] In this embodiment, the side clamping mechanism 13 includes clamping arm plates 132 disposed on the left and right sides of the casing 1 and a longitudinal drive mechanism for driving the clamping arm plates 132 to perform clamping actions. The clamping arm plates almost cover the side of the casing, ensuring simultaneous clamping and compression of the entire side of the packaging area. Under the action of the longitudinal drive mechanism, the clamping arm plates 132 can perform longitudinal clamping actions in the packaging area. As shown in the figure, the Y direction represents the transverse direction, the X direction represents the longitudinal direction, and the Z direction represents the vertical direction. The longitudinal drive mechanism provides the force required for the clamping action of the corresponding clamping arm plates, ensuring that the material in the packaging area is uniformly compressed and shaped on both sides. Several parallel crossbeam plates 12 are provided on both the left and right sides of the casing 1 in the packaging area. The clamping arm plates 132 are arranged one-to-one with the crossbeam plates 12. The clamping arm plates 132 have a U-shaped structure and are inserted and slidably engaged with the crossbeam plates. The front panel of the clamping arm plates 132 is located inside the casing. The front panel is a smooth panel to reduce frictional resistance and facilitate the passage of the packaging material. A wire groove 11 is provided between two adjacent clamping arm plates 132. The wire groove facilitates the passage and exit of the binding rope, and makes it easy to bind and knot. One end of the clamping arm plate 132 is hinged to the crossbeam plate 12 through the second pin 134. Multiple clamping arm plates 132 swing back and forth synchronously around the second pin under the action of the longitudinal drive mechanism, clamping the material in the packaging area on both sides, forming a two-sided extrusion, which facilitates rapid forming.
[0037] like Figure 5 , 7 As shown, the longitudinal drive mechanism in this embodiment adopts linear longitudinal drive. Specifically, the longitudinal drive mechanism includes a clamping arm base 3-1 set on the side wall of the packaging area of the chassis 1. The clamping arm base 3-1 is provided with a longitudinal drive component 133, which is a first telescopic hydraulic cylinder. The first telescopic hydraulic cylinder is fixed inside the clamping arm base 3-1, and the rod of the first telescopic hydraulic cylinder extends out of the clamping arm base 3-1 and is connected to a connecting plate seat 3-2. The connecting plate seat 3-2 is correspondingly arranged with the clamping arm plate 132. The clamping arm base adopts a box-type seat, and the telescopic hydraulic cylinder is fixed inside the clamping arm base, which makes the structure more compact and provides dust protection. The connecting plate seat can be connected to the rod of the telescopic hydraulic cylinder using bolts. The connecting plate seat 3-2 is correspondingly arranged with the clamping arm plate 132; the longitudinal drive component drives the clamping arm plate to move through the connecting plate seat, so that it is evenly stressed. The connecting plate seat 3-2 and the clamping arm plate 132 can be connected by a pin hinge. Power transmission is carried out by contact rather than connection. During the compression action, the longitudinal telescopic cylinder contacts the rear support plate of the clamping arm plate through the connecting plate seat and pushes the clamping arm plate to move into the machine box to squeeze and compact the material in the packaging area. After compaction and packaging, the telescopic cylinder retracts, the connecting plate seat disengages from the clamping arm plate, and the clamping arm plate is pushed back to its original position by the pusher plate of the transverse pusher during the material pushing process.
[0038] Example 6, as Figure 6 , 8As shown, a double-head baler is further optimized based on Embodiment 1 or 2. The difference between this embodiment and Embodiment 3 is that the longitudinal drive mechanism in this embodiment adopts a rotary shaft drive, specifically including rotary shaft arm assemblies 131 arranged on both sides of the transverse outlet. A longitudinal drive component 133 connects the two rotary shaft arm assemblies 131 on both sides, linking them together to ensure that the clamping arm plates on both sides simultaneously perform clamping and compression actions. The clamping arm plates 132 are arranged on the left and right sides of the machine housing 1, near the hatch 4; they clamp the material near the hatch on both sides, making it easier to exit the hatch while clamping and compressing it. The clamping arm plates 132 are configured to cooperate with the side walls of the machine housing, forming surface compression of the internal material. The rotary shaft arm assemblies 31 are integrated with the hatch on both sides of the transverse outlet, reducing the number of components in the machine housing baling area, reducing the transverse dimensions of the machine housing baling area, and making the structure more compact.
[0039] The pivot arm assembly 131 includes a vertically arranged pivot 3101 and several pivot arms 3102 arranged axially on the pivot 3101. The pivot 3101 is rotatably arranged on the left and right sides of the transverse outlet of the chassis 1. An arm plate 137 is fixedly mounted on the upper part of the pivot 3101. The longitudinal drive component 133 is a telescopic cylinder, and both ends of the telescopic cylinder are hinged to the arm plate 137. The pivot arms 3102 are correspondingly arranged with the clamping arm plate 132. The corresponding arrangement means that the pivot arm is in contact with the clamping arm plate but not connected when the clamping arm plate is in its initial position. Two crank arms form a group, with the two crank arms in the same group corresponding to the two rear support plates at the same height. During compression, the telescopic cylinder extends, driving the rotating shaft and crank arms to rotate forward. The crank arms contact and press against the rear support plates, pushing the clamping arm plates towards the inside of the machine casing to compress the material in the packaging area. After compaction and packaging, the telescopic cylinder retracts, driving the rotating shaft and crank arms to rotate in the opposite direction, and the crank arms disengage from the rear support plates. During the process of the transverse pusher pushing the material, the pusher plate of the transverse pusher pushes the clamping arm plates back to their original position. The longitudinal drive component can also be a cylinder, and the drive component that provides the left and right swinging power for the clamping arm plates belongs to the same inventive concept as the telescopic cylinder of this utility model. The front panels of several clamping arm plates are located in the same plane to perform planar contact compression of the material, ensuring the quality of compression and packaging.
[0040] In addition, such as Figure 9As shown, it should be noted that the chassis also includes conventional components such as a hydraulic pump station 10 to ensure the normal operation of the equipment. A rope hook unit module 8 can also be installed on the side wall of chassis 1 corresponding to the packing area. The rope hook unit module 8 can be detachably connected to the chassis as an independent installation module, facilitating assembly and transportation. The rope hook unit module 8 includes a box-shaped frame 81, which is detachably connected to chassis 1. The top of the box-shaped frame 81 is equipped with a lifting ring for easy lifting and installation. The rope hook is a smooth rod with a pointed tip, and the pointed tip has a hook groove for hooking and binding rope. Rope hooks 83 are correspondingly arranged with wire grooves 11 on chassis 1, and the number of rope hooks 83 corresponds one-to-one with the number of wire grooves 11. The longitudinal sliding frame 82, under the action of the longitudinal telescopic drive component 84, drives the rope hooks 83 to move relative to chassis 1. The longitudinal telescopic drive component 84 can be an existing hydraulic cylinder or pneumatic cylinder, or it can be a structure of a motor plus a sprocket and chain. Specifically, a small sprocket is set at the front of the box-shaped frame, and a motor is set at the rear of the frame. A large sprocket is set on the motor, and a chain is set between the small sprocket and the large sprocket. The longitudinal sliding frame is connected to the chain. The movement of the chain drives the longitudinal sliding frame to move longitudinally, thus determining whether the rope hook is inserted into the machine box. When the rope hook is inserted into the machine box, it pulls the binding rope on the opposite side of the machine box to that side for easy knotting.
